Live Company Group Plc is a global enterprise focused on the live events and entertainment sector, with operations spanning the UK, Europe, North America, Asia, the Middle East, and Africa. Its operations are divided into three distinct divisions: Models and Sets, Tours and Trails, and Sports and Entertainment. The company collaborates with licensed partners and venue managers to facilitate and manage its BRICKLIVE brand of shows, events, and exhibitions. Furthermore, it supplies content and technical assistance to its partners, alongside offering entry to premier international sports and entertainment spectacles. Established in 1959, Live Company Group Plc maintains its principal office in West Byfleet, United Kingdom.

What is a company's Operating Margin?
The operating margin is a key indicator to assess the profitability of a company. Higher operating margins are generaly better as they show that a company is able to sell its products or services for much more than their production costs. The operating margin is calculated by dividing a company's earnings by its revenue.
